Starting Point at Smedsudden on Kungsholmen

The adventure begins at the Smedsudden area on Kungsholmen, a peaceful spot on Stockholm’s western shore. The location is convenient, right in the city, meaning you won’t need long commutes or complicated transfers to get on the water. The staff from LEK MER Kayak & SUP are friendly, ready to help you gear up, answer questions, and ensure you’re comfortable before pushing off.

Once you’re equipped with a high-quality kayak, paddle, lifejacket, sprayskirt, map, and instructions, you’re set. The instructions are straightforward, and if you’re new to kayaking, the staff will give you a quick demo and safety tips. Many reviews highlight how welcoming and helpful the staff are, with some mentioning how “the friendly team made everything feel simple, even for beginners.”

What You Can Expect During Your Paddle

Your route will take you through some of Stockholm’s most charming waterways. You might paddle past Långholmen, a former prison island turned lively neighborhood, or near the majestic Stockholm City Hall, famous for its Nobel Banquet. If you’re feeling adventurous, you can explore parts of Old Town, with its narrow canals and historic buildings, or glide along Karlbergskanalen, a scenic waterway that offers a different perspective of the city.

The scenery is a major highlight. Many reviewers note how the views from the water reveal a side of Stockholm that’s often missed—swimming past historic buildings, lush islands, and bustling docks, all framed by a skyline that blends the old and the new.

Practical Tips for Your Kayaking Day

Stockholm: Self-Guided Kayak Tour 1 or 2 Person Kayak Rental - Practical Tips for Your Kayaking Day

  • Dress appropriately for getting a little wet—quick-drying clothes, water-resistant shoes, and sunscreen are advisable.
  • Bring a water bottle; staying hydrated is important, especially during sunny weather.
  • If you want to keep your belongings dry, consider bringing a drybag (not included).
  • Start your paddle early or mid-morning to avoid peak hours and enjoy calmer waters.
  • Remember, no alcohol or drugs are allowed on the water, to keep everyone safe.
  • Pay attention to weather conditions; avoid paddling in high winds or storms.
  • Take your time—two hours can fly by if you stop for photos or a quick picnic on an island!
